AgriITs
Bạn có muốn phản ứng với tin nhắn này? Vui lòng đăng ký diễn đàn trong một vài cú nhấp chuột hoặc đăng nhập để tiếp tục.

Cấu hình mạng cơ bản cho Fedora từ dòng lệnh...

Go down

Cấu hình mạng cơ bản cho Fedora từ dòng lệnh... Empty Cấu hình mạng cơ bản cho Fedora từ dòng lệnh...

Bài gửi  dathai1710 Sat Sep 15, 2007 1:02 am

Giao diện chính để cấu hình networking từ CLI trong Linux là chương trình ifconfig, nằm trong thư mục /sbin

[root@localhost /]# ifconfig
eth0 Link encap:Ethernet HWaddr 00:06:5B:5D:04:22
inet addr:10.0.5.201 Bcast:10.0.5.255 Mask:255.255.255.0
inet6 addr: fe80::206:5bff:fe5d:422/64 Scope:Link
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:2973 errors:0 dropped:0 overruns:1 frame:0
TX packets:2367 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:3200880 (3.0 MiB) TX bytes:204032 (199.2 KiB)
Interrupt:177 Base address:0xac00

lo Link encap:Local Loopback
inet addr:127.0.0.1 Mask:255.0.0.0
inet6 addr: ::1/128 Scope:Host
UP LOOPBACK RUNNING MTU:16436 Metric:1
RX packets:1695 errors:0 dropped:0 overruns:0 frame:0
TX packets:1695 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:0
RX bytes:3804492 (3.6 MiB) TX bytes:3804492 (3.6 MiB)

ở đây có 2 interface: eth0, lo (loopback)
Với mỗi interface, thông tin hiển thị bao gồm:
-Địa chị IPv4 inet
-Địa chỉ IPv6 inet6
-Netmask
-Status của kết nối: vd up, running
-Các thông số về transmit, receive, và error
Muốn xem cấu hình của một interface, bạn chỉ cần thêm vào tham số là tên interface đằng sau ifconfig
[root@localhost /]# ifconfig eth0
eth0 Link encap:Ethernet HWaddr 00:06:5B:5D:04:22
inet addr:10.0.5.201 Bcast:10.0.5.255 Mask:255.255.255.0
inet6 addr: fe80::206:5bff:fe5d:422/64 Scope:Link
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:3575 errors:0 dropped:0 overruns:1 frame:0
TX packets:2438 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:3244934 (3.0 MiB) TX bytes:215474 (210.4 KiB)
Interrupt:177 Base address:0xac00

[root@localhost /]#
.
Bây giờ chúng ta cấu hình lại ip và netmask cho interface eht0:
[root@localhost /]# ifconfig eth0 up 10.0.5.206 netmask 255.255.255.0 broadcast 10.0.5.255
[root@localhost /]# ifconfig
eth0 Link encap:Ethernet HWaddr 00:06:5B:5D:04:22
inet addr:10.0.5.206 Bcast:10.0.5.255 Mask:255.255.255.0
inet6 addr: fe80::206:5bff:fe5d:422/64 Scope:Link
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:53636 errors:0 dropped:0 overruns:1 frame:0
TX packets:38292 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:59950045 (57.1 MiB) TX bytes:3259089 (3.1 MiB)
Interrupt:177 Base address:0xac00

Trong hầu hết các trường hợp, chúng ta có thể bỏ qua option broadcast do địa chỉ broadcast có thể được tính thông qua IP và netmask. Nếu không cấu hình thông số netmask thì ifconfig sẽ lấy theo subnet mask mặc định.

Subnetmask mặc định của các IP lớp A là 255.0.0.0, lớp B là 255.255.255.0, lớp C là 255.255.255.0


What a Face Chúc các bác thành công.........!!
dathai1710
dathai1710

Tổng số bài gửi : 116
Registration date : 15/09/2007

Về Đầu Trang Go down

Về Đầu Trang


 
Permissions in this forum:
Bạn không có quyền trả lời bài viết